[Controlled respiration in patients with severe neurological diseases. Syndrome of functional changes]
Neurologia I Neurochirurgia Polska
|May 1, 1975
Abstract:
The investigations were carried out on a group of neurological patients treated by means of assisted or controlled respiration from respirators. Volumetric and gasometric measurements were performed and radiological examinations of the chest were done periodically. The obtained results suggest that neurological patients constitute a specific group with a more rapid fall in the values of VC and PaO2, increased alveolar-capillary gradient (PA-a) and decreased actual compliance delta t/ delta p.
